Day
1

Welcome to Delhi, India

Check in to the exceptional ITC Maurya Hotel in the heart of New Delhi.

Day
2

Sightseeing with your personal car, driver and guide

Begin your day along the Rajpath, laid out by the British more than a century ago. Then marvel at the Red Fort c and explore the old Chandni Chowk market by pedicab. Visit India’s largest mosque and Sikh Temple and finish your day at two World Heritage Sites: Qutab Minar c and Humayun’s Tomb c. Meals B,D

Day
3

Fly to Kathmandu, Nepal

Upon arrival, transfer by private car to the Dwarikas Hotel. Meals B

Day
4

Mt. Everest and Kathmandu

Weather permitting, an early morning flight-seeing excursion offers inspiring views of Mt. Everest. After breakfast, your private tour includes Durbar Square, the Mahadev & Parvati Temple and Hamuman Dhoka, the city’s ancient royal quarter. In the afternoon, travel through the Nepalese countryside to visit Patan, founded in 250 AD and famed for its traditional architecture. Meals B

Day
5

Explore the Kathmandu Valley c

Travel with your private car, driver and guide into the lovely Kathmandu Valley to explore ancient Bhadgaon, one of the three kingdoms of medieval Nepal. Then visit Bodhnath, the largest stupa in Nepal and venerated by both Tibetan and Nepalese Buddhists. Before returning to your hotel, stop along the River Bagmati to see Pashupatinath Temple, dedicated to Lord Shiva. This evening’s dinner features traditional Nepalese cuisine and entertainment. Meals B,D

Day
6

Fly to the Kingdom of Bhutan

Fly to Paro and embark on a scenic overland journey by private car to Thimphu. Check in to the Taj Tashi Hotel and enjoy an evening at leisure. Meals B,L,D

Day
7

Explore Thimpu

Your full-day private tour includes the National Library, home to a priceless collection of Buddhist manuscripts, and the Painting School, dedicated to the preservation of Bhutan’s 13 traditional arts. In the afternoon, continue to the imposing Trashichhoedzong Fortress, built in 1641, and the King’s Memorial Chorten, continuously circumambulated by pilgrims chanting mantras and spinning their prayer wheels. Meals B,L,D

Day
8

The magnificent Paro Valley

The ascent to the oft-photographed Tiger’s Nest Monastery is a bit steep, but the invigorating journey is well rewarded with awe-inspiring views of the cliff-side monastery and surrounding mountains. Then visit Ta Dzong to see an impressive collection of antique Thangka paintings and textiles. Overnight at the Uma Paro Hotel. Meals B,L,D

Day
9

Depart Paro

Our tour services end this morning after breakfast. Meals B

Extend Your Trip

See North India before Nepal & Bhutan

8-day Pre-Tour Extension from $1,999

This comprehensive Private Tour of northern India is a great way to enhance your journey.

Day
1

From Delhi to Jaipur

Depart the capital and journey through the colorful Rajasthani countryside to Jaipur, where you’ll check in to the deluxe ITC Rajputana Hotel. This evening, stroll with your personal guide through a bustling city market filled with colorful shops and vendor stalls, many owned by the same family for generations. Along the say, your guide will show you hot to don a traditional saree and turban.

Day
2

Explore Jaipur

Tour the extravagant Amber Fort, home to palaces, courtyard gardens and the lovely Chamber of Mirrors. See the oft-photographed Palace of Winds, tour the City Palace Museum and visit Jantar Mantar, an extraordinary observatory with accurate stone instruments built in 1726.  Meals B

Day
3

Onward to Agra

Explore the magnificent “ghost town” of Fatehpur Sikri, built and then mysteriously abandoned in the 16th century – but still in pristine condition! Continue to Agra and check in to the opulent ITC Mughal Hotel.  Meals B

Day
4

The Taj Mahal and Agra Fort

Arise early this morning for a sunrise visit to the Taj Mahal, an unforgettable spectacle as the sun casts its first golden light upon the iridescent marble of this monument to love. Return to your hotel for a hearty breakfast and then tour the impressive Agra Fort, begun in 1565 by the great Emperor Akbar.

This evening, you’ll return to the Taj Mahal to watch as the setting sun seems to magically change the hues of its glowing, pearly white façade.  Meals B

Day
5

Onward to Orchha and Khajuraho

After breakfast, you’ll be escorted by private car to the rail station to board the Shatabdi Express Train bound for Jhansi. Upon arrival, you’ll be met and driven to Orchha for a private sightseeing tour of this celebrated medieval city, the site of several magnificent temples and palaces of the Bundela Dynasty. After lunch, continue to Khajuraho and check in to the 5-star Taj Chandela Hotel. Meals B,L

Day
6

Discover the temples of Khajuraho and fly to Varanasi

This morning’s private sightseeing shows you the most significant of the town’s spectacular 10th-century temples. Many are famously adorned with erotic carvings and all are notable for the near-perfect balance they strike between architecture and sculpture. Then transfer to the airport for your included flight to Varanasi where you’ll be met and driven to the Taj Gateway Hotel. After time to refresh, you’ll visit Sarnath – revered as the place where Buddha gave his first sermon.

This evening, we’ve arranged for you to observe the Aarti Ceremony, an evocative Hindu ritual of light and praise which unfolds along the sacred River Ganges.  Meals B

Day
7

Explore Varanasi

Set out at dawn for a boat ride on the Ganges as thousands of devotees descend to the holy waters for purification. It’s a daily ritual which has unfolded here for thousands of years, and it is one of the most powerful scenes of humanity you will ever witness. Then tour the most important shore temples of the Ganges and later learn how the city’s intricately beautiful silks are woven.  Meals B

Day
8

Back to Delhi

Enjoy a morning Yoga session at your hotel and then transfer to the airport for you flight to Delhi. Upon arrival, you’ll be met and driven to the 5-star ITC Maurya Hotel for the start of your 9-day Private Tour.  Meals B
